Erosion Control Construction

Level sloped or uneven terrain with a professionally built structural terrace by a licensed contractor in King County. These structures do more than prevent erosion—they add visual interest and create usable space in challenging yards. Using materials like timber, stone, or interlocking blocks, a certified landscape architect designs walls that blend function with aesthetic appeal,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all.

Proper site grading and backfill are critical, so always hire a reputable hardscape contractor. They’ll integrate drainage solutions like weep holes and gravel layers to ensure long-term stability and performance in the Pacific Northwest climate.

Ground and Water Flow Testing

Analyzing your soil composition and drainage capacity is crucial for long-term landscape health. In Sammamish WA, where clay-heavy soils and frequent rain are common, a landscape architect conducts percolation tests to determine the best planting and construction strategies. Poor drainage leads to erosion, plant loss, and foundation issues—problems easily avoided with expert assessment.

Local and Drought-Tolerant Yard Design

Local Ecosystem Regional Vegetation

Strengthen local biodiversity by incorporating Pacific Northwest species into your garden design. These plants thrive in Sammamish’s climate, require less watering, and support pollinators like bees and butterflies. A certified landscape architect selects species like red flowering currant, sword fern, and Oregon grape for year-round texture and resilience.

How Is a Landscape Architect Different From a Landscape Designer in King County?

In King County, a certified professional has completed formal education, passed rigorous exams, and is qualified to manage complex projects involving structural hardscapes. While a garden designer may focus on plant selection and basic layout, a outdoor design expert can also design irrigation systems and collaborate with a engineering specialist when needed. For projects requiring permits or major earthwork, hiring a credentialed landscape architect ensures compliance and safety.
